Welcome aboard! One of your quarterly chores as release manager at Brindlewick is archiving cold storage buckets once a release train ships. Basically: anything in the frostvault tier older than 90 days gets compressed and moved to deep archive. It's mostly automated, but you need to kick off the job and sign off on the manifest. The full step-by-step checklist lives on our internal wiki page.

operations page: https://jenkins.zemvarcloud.local/job/merge_requests/repo/build/73930b4b30f0a8ed

Subject: Release handover — Lanternbay API

Handing over Lanternbay public REST API releases. Main open item: pagination. We moved from offset-based to cursor-based in v3; v2 endpoints still accept offsets until the deprecation date in the roadmap doc. Watch for partners hardcoding page numbers — their integrations break silently. Release cadence is biweekly, changelog goes out the same day. Artifacts must be signed before publishing, using the key below.

deploy key for kahif-kagag: bky6_P9MRJj

Archiving a cold storage bucket in the Vantle Storage API is a two-step operation: first call the seal endpoint, which freezes writes and computes a final manifest, then call archive to move objects into glacier-tier media. Sealed buckets remain readable for up to 72 hours before the move completes. Both calls are idempotent and safe to retry. Each request must authenticate with the bearer token below.

session JWT of yawep-yawep = eyJhbGciOiJIUzI1NiIsInR5cCI6IkpXVCJ9.eyJzdWIiOiI3pWF3_In0.aXYsHiog

## Service Accounts — QueueFlex Autoscaler

The `qf-scaler` service account polls Brimhall's queue-depth metrics every 15s and calls the Scaleboard API to adjust worker counts. Scope is read-metrics plus write-scale only; no deploy permissions. Reviewers: confirm any new endpoint added to the scaler stays within these scopes. Rotation is quarterly via the Vaultlet job. For local review builds, authenticate against the staging Scaleboard with the key below.

gateway credential: qvz15-KH6w5OvQFD1Z8FT